Can I use Dolby Atmos speakers with Xbox Series X?
Yes, Xbox Series X supports Dolby Atmos, which means you can use compatible Dolby Atmos speakers to enjoy immersive 3D audio. Dolby Atmos speakers can be a soundbar, home theater system, or headphones. Dolby Atmos for headphones is available through the Dolby Access app on your Xbox Series X.
